Browse all contacts at Maersk Global Service Centres India Private Limited (Powai, Mumbai

Contact people working at Maersk Global Service Centres India Private Limited (Powai, Mumbai, Maersk Global Service Centres India Private Limited (Powai, Mumbai employees, Maersk Global Service Centres India Private Limited (Powai, Mumbai contacts

Other employees and contacts in Maersk Global Service Centres India Private Limited (Powai, Mumbai
1